Binance Coin (BNB) Takes A Tumble

Nicholas Merten’s analysis suggests that Binance Coin (BNB) could face a significant decline, potentially exceeding a 38% drop from its current value. This projection is based on BNB’s recent dip below two critical long-term support levels. Over the past few months, BNB has struggled to breach the $350 mark in 2023, leading to a sharp reversal that brought its price down to approximately $200. This price movement is visually represented as a falling wedge pattern on the one-day chart.

The concerning aspect is that BNB is now challenging the support trendline of this falling wedge pattern. Currently trading at $211.25, it has shown a 1.4% increase in the past 24 hours.

Ripple (XRP) Faces Sell Pressure

Nicholas Merten predicts short-term pressure on the XRP price, with the potential for a substantial 70% drop due to a significant sell-off. Recent technical indicators, such as the “death cross” between the 50 and 200 Moving Averages (MAs) on the weekly charts, suggest a bearish sentiment in the short term.

Also, Merten advises potential XRP investors to exercise caution and wait for a support level test at $0.15 before considering it as a speculative asset. As of now, XRP is trading at $0.50, with a slight 0.4% increase in the last 24 hours.

Cardano (ADA) to Dip Low

In the case of Cardano (ADA), Merten foresees a drop of more than 37% from its current value. Despite some optimism regarding the formation of a potential triple-bottom pattern, the analyst highlights consistent resistance and weakening relative highs over time, indicating a potential decline to $0.15.

Ethereum (ETH) is Struggling Too!

Ethereum (ETH) is also facing challenges, having been locked in a bearish cycle since April 2023 and struggling to maintain support above $2,000. Currently trading at $1,588, ETH has found some stability around the $1,425 mark after grappling with the $1,500 level.

According to Merten, there may be a brief downturn in September, but he anticipates potential adoption to take place in October if all goes according to plan.
